Turpo
Turpo is a town in Turpo District, Andahuaylas Province, Apurímac Department and has about 739 residents and an elevation of 3,312 metres. Turpo is situated nearby to the hamlet Ticapata, as well as near Trampa.| Tap on a place to explore it |
